Marcus, looking forward to hearing all of your stories today. Do you wish you had started you own firm sooner?
I normally don’t have regrets but thinking back on certain situations, as a 29 year old, I have learned not to waste seamless amounts of time. Some backstory, I started producing in 2009, juggling my last few years of high school, work and even extra curricular activities. The pressure of what something different than what your family wants can take a real toll. I loved music and everything about it but I was not the best idea according to my mother. Despite the friction, in 2011, I decided to go to college for Music Business. Ended up picking the wrong location for my job choice and that itself is very crucial. After 2 years of partying and less studies, I ended up dropping out and just focused on regular home life, which basically consisted of 40 how work weeks at Walmart. My desire for music basically diminished at this point until I had a sudden spark and entertained the idea of moving to my dream city, Atlanta, GA. Started attending The Art Institute of Atlanta and started getting back in the music groove. Started interning at Soul Asylum Studios and at the point I was living the life in music. Only one crucial miss, I focused more on engineering and basically stunted growth in my music production. From 2013-2017 I probably made 20 beats, but my engineering was immaculate. I was even recording the neo-soul Angie Stone. Don’t get me wrong, I still do and love engineering , but production is my first love. Then from 2017-2021 I took on another career and starting my own trucking company. If you think timing was crazy before, these years took a lot from me, even things I still suffer today. Now I’m focusing on production the majority of my time, and have accomplished so much in a year and a half and I couldn’t help but think, where would I be if ai would’ve taken my craft more serious, if I would’ve taken myself more serious. I’ll never know but I know my path now and refuse to waste anymore valuable time. All I all, I do wish I would’ve done this way sooner though.
